  • The Gruhlsee is one of the smaller lakes in the Ville lake chain and is a nutrient-poor, calcareous body of still water near Brühl-Heide. Like all other bodies of water in the chain, the Gruhlsee is an artificial residual lake with shallow water zones created by former brown coal open-cast mines, surrounded by larger forest areas with mixed trees typical of the location. Poplars, pines, red oaks, larches, alders, beeches, robinias and birches alternate. Source: Wikipedia

  • The Gruhlsee is under landscape protection and is one of the numerous Villeseen that were created in the course of lignite mining.
